Celtics taking chance on Miles

When you're the reigning world champions, you can afford to take some chances. That's what the Celtics did by signing free agent forward Darius Miles yesterday. Miles, a 6-foot-9 forward, hasn't played in the NBA for two years due to microfracture surgery on his right knee. Terms of the deal were not announced. "Darius has been in twice for workouts with us and has impressed us with his progress, health and attitude," Celtics director of basketball operations Danny Ainge said. "Darius will have the next couple of months to prove to myself and coach (Doc) Rivers that he can help us win." The signing has little monetary risk for the Celtics, given that Miles is already assured of making $18 million over the next two seasons from his guaranteed contract with Portland. According to reports, if Miles plays 10 games for the C's, the remaining $18 million of his six-year, $48 million salary goes back on Trail Blazers' books.
